Addocat® DB

Addocat® DB is a catalyst for the production of PUR foam, example flexible ester slabstock foam and rigid foam.

    Application Information
    • Flexible ester slabstock foam: Addocat® DB is a catalyst for the production of flexible ester foam based mainly on TDI 65/35. 1.0 - 1.6 parts by weight Addocat® DB per 100 parts by weight polyester polyol are used, depending on the water content of the formulation (2.0 - 5.0 parts by weight water). Since Addocat® DB is insoluble in water, it can be emulsified in a mixture of water, Addovate® WM and Addovate®SM.
    • Rigid foam: Addocat® DB is a weak catalyst for the crosslinking reaction. It is often used as a co-catalyst and gives rigid foam a tough and slightly elastic surface, especially in polyester polyol containing systems.
    Product Applications
    • Addocat® DB is used mainly in the continuous production of slabstock foam with densities higher than 50 kg/m3. Depending on the desired density, Addovate® SM can be used simultaneously (at dosages of 1.0 - 4.0 parts by weight Addovate® SM)
    • On-site casting
    • Continuous production of building boards with flexible and rigid or metal facings.

    Storage & Handling

    Storage Conditions
    • Addocat® DB is to be stored in a cool and dry place.
    • When Addocat® DB is stored in firmly closed original containers at dry conditions at approx. 20 °C, a shelf-life of 24 months from manufacturing date can be expected.
    • When storing the product for long periods, especially at temperatures above 30 °C, diskoloration may occur even in closed original containers.
    • This does not have a negative impact on catalytic activity.
    • The containers should be resealed tightly after use to prevent contamination by impurities and exposure to moisture.
